Transaction 5157142e57895dce204862e2a63ab08dd7391af959ba9c86b000b5ef10169511

1 Input
2 Outputs
  • 5157142e57895dce204862e2a63ab08dd7391af959ba9c86b000b5ef10169511:0
  • value  503002
    address  34P5VNxjTow8JZVYFKnjMVfq29fnVUgiDz
  • 5157142e57895dce204862e2a63ab08dd7391af959ba9c86b000b5ef10169511:1
  • value  50774
    address  3BVEmRTsdVzn8saVhcB8oeDoMQUhhes86e